Removing the Enclosure Cover
Important: The cover should only be removed by qualified service personnel as it provides access to a
service area.
Note: Before performing any maintenance on the storage system, back up all data. Shut down
the storage system by selecting the Advanced tab from the Manager and then Shutdown
from the left-hand menu.
1. Observe all safety and ESD precautions listed in
2. If you cannot shut down the system using the software Manager then power down the
storage system by pressing and holding the power button for approximately five
seconds until the System Status LED starts flashing. The storage system shuts off after
a short shutdown period.
Caution: Ensure the system is completely shutdown before removing the power chord.
3. Disconnect the storage system from its power source.
4. Remove the four screws at the back of the enclosure cover. See letter "A" in the
following figure. Slide the enclosure cover slightly rearward and then lift up. See
letter "B".
